**Vendor note: Inkmill markdown pipeline**

Rendering for Parchway docs is outsourced to Inkmill under an annual contract, renewing each March. They handle sanitization and PDF export; we own the upload queue. SLA: 4-hour response on rendering failures. Escalate only after two failed retries. Their support desk is reachable at the address below.

billing contact of hahaf-baguf = zorael.tammir.jorius@sivrelhq.internal

# Client setup for the Murkfen nightly backfill scheduler.
#
# This scheduler wakes at 02:00 local, enumerates partitions that
# missed their daily load, and replays them against the warehouse
# ingest endpoint. New folks: never point this at production without
# a dry-run flag first. The ingest endpoint requires the internal
# service key, which is provided below.

API key for tagug-tajef: vxb4-R1fo

Subject: Handover — Ledgerlight audit-log viewer

Taking over releases from me as of Monday. Quick notes for plugin authors on the thread: viewer 3.2 ships the new filter API; deprecated hooks removed in 3.4. Audit entries are now immutable post-write — don't let plugins mutate the payload or verification breaks. Release cadence stays biweekly. Pipeline is green, last build signed yesterday. Plugins must be re-signed against the rotated key before the next window. For verification, the current signing key follows.

signing key of bagap-yawep = bky13_TbfT6ZMUoGJo2

# Break-Glass: Catalog Cache Invalidation

Scope: the Pinrow product catalog at Veldstone Retail. If stale prices persist after a purge and the Hollowmere invalidation queue is wedged, use break-glass to flush the edge tier directly. Contractors: get verbal sign-off from the catalog lead first. Steps: open the Hollowmere admin shell, select emergency-flush, confirm the tenant, and run it once — repeated flushes thrash the origin. Access is logged and expires after 20 minutes. Unseal the admin shell with the passphrase below.

recovery phrase for kahop-tajog: istix-casvan